The University of Cebu (UC) is an educational institution in Cebu City, Philippines founded in 1964 by Atty. Augusto W. Go. With over 44,000 students from pre-school to post-graduate students in 4 campuses, UC is the country’s private university. UC is consistently producing topnotchers in Board exams for Engineering, Maritime Studies, Marine Engineering, Naval Architecture, Nursing, Accounting, Criminology and Customs Administration. In 2012, 5 out of the top 10 places in Mechanical Engineering went to UC. While the university is one of the youngest Law Schools in the country, it has produced 2 of the top 10 places in the Bar Exams in successive years. In 2008, UC signed an agreement with the Norwegian Shipowner’s Association to educate approximately 900 maritime scholars. These scholars enjoy free tuition, board and lodging, books and uniforms. To date, UC has around 1,000 maritime scholars from local and international companies and most are assured of employment after graduation. The university is recognized as one of the top 10 universities nation-wide with the most number of accredited programs by the Philippine Association of Colleges and Universities – Commission on Accreditation (PACU-COA) in 2004. Awarded with ISO and Det Norske Veritas (DNV) accreditation in 1998, UC played an important role in allowing Filipino seafarers to continue working onboard international vessels and ensure the continuous flow of billions of pesos in overseas remittances. |

Candice Gotianuy, MA is a graduate of Masters in Education from Harvard University, Cambridge. She oversees the country’s largest private university as Chancellor of the University of Cebu. At age 21, she was the youngest University Chancellor in the country. Ms. Gotianuy also holds different positions such as Proprietor (Whistlejacket Farm), President (University of Cebu Medical Center), Managing Director (St. Vincent’s General Hospital), President (College of Technological Sciences), Treasurer (Chelsea Land Development Corporation), Vice-President (Gotianuy Realty Corporation), Director (Cebu Central Realty Corporation), Director (Visayan Surety and Insurance Corporation), Executive VP (AWG Development Corporation), and Honorary Consul of Norway in Cebu. |

Dean Ofelia Mana, MST-CS is the Campus Director of the University of Cebu-Banilad Campus. She finished an Executive Development Program at Maastricht School of Management, Netherlands, MS in Teaching major in Computer Science at De la Salle University, and BS in Business Administration (graduated CUM LAUDE) at Siliman University. Her work experiences include Dean (College of Computer Science, University of Cebu-Main), Director (Siliman University Computer Center), Education Head (United Computer Programming), Vice-President (ENZIO Consultancy Clinic), Assistant Professor (Siliman University), and Administrative Staff (Universal Robina Corporation). Currently, she is a candidate Doctor in Organizational Development and Transofrmation at the Cebu Doctors’ University in Cebu City Philippines. |
Melvin M. Ninal, Ph.D. is currently the Dean of the College of Computer Studies of University of Cebu as well as UC’s OBE/OBTL Unit Head. He was the university’s Innovation and Technology Support Office (ITSO) Manager from 2011 to 2014. Prior to joining UC, he was faculty and dean of CCS at Southwestern University in Cebu City for 8 years. He finished his PhD in Educational Management at University of Bohol and his Master of Science in Information Technology (MSIT) at University of San Jose-Recoletos. He earned his Bachelor of Science in Information Technology (BSIT) at Cebu Institute of Technology-University. |

Sheryl B. Satorre, Ph.D. works as a college instructor at the University of Cebu-Main. She has mentored more than 30 startup-based Capstone Projects. She also serves as a mentor for various startup competitions and boot camps like Philippine Startup Challenge, Smart SWEEP Excellence and Innovation Award, Startup Weekend, and Cebu Launchpad. She finished her PhD in Technology Management at Cebu Technological University, MA in Teaching major in ICT at Southwestern University, and BS in Mathematics major in Computer Science at Cebu Institute of Technology-University. Her Ph.D. dissertation entitled, “Cebu City Technology Startup Ecosystem”, assessed the vibrancy of the local startup key players, and produced the Cebu City Startup Ecosystem Canvas. |
